Jamieson, Fausset & Brown
Robert Jamieson, A. R. Fausset & David Brown · Commentary Critical and Explanatory on the Whole Bible · 19th-century historical commentary
“went . . . to war against Hazael, king of Syria--It may be mentioned as a very minute and therefore important confirmation of this part of the sacred history that the names of Jehu and Hazael, his contemporary, have both been found on Assyrian sculptures; and there is also a notice of Ithbaal, king of Sidon, who was the father of Jezebel.”

Tyndale Open Study Notes
Tyndale House Publishers · Tyndale Open Study Notes · Modern study notes
“22:5-6 Ramoth-gilead, a Levitical city in the territory of Gad (Josh 21:38), was located on a major trade route and was strategic for Aram and Israel. • Jezreel, at the foot of Mount Gilboa in the plain of Jezreel, became the summer home of the Israelite kings.”
